u/Hue_Boss iPhone 15 Pro, 17.2.1 11h ago
It’s good to be excited but this announcement needs to be taken cautiously.
This project has some downsides which makes it, so the wait for the upcoming Dopamine 3.0 is rather recommended.
The exploits in this Jailbreak were developed using AI which leads to issues. Especially when the developer seen in this picture is known to create Jailbreak software (e.g Saily) that’s poorly developed and causes trouble.
The other part is roothide Dopamine being the base of this project. Tweak support is generally much worse.
You also won’t have support for devices below A15 or in the iOS 16.5.1-17.0 range. If Dopamine follows shortly after, it’ll likely be impossible to move the existing Jailbreak setup.
These are all reasons why waiting is the key here. [u/Alfiecg](u/Alfiecg) is doing incredible work reversing the Coruna PPL/SPTM bypass by hand and the before mentioned Dopamine update shouldn’t be too far off. It’ll be a better experience surely.
On another note, that should be Dopamine support with the following update:
A8-A11: until iOS 18.7.1 (iOS 15.8.8/16.7.16 EOL on iPhones, iOS 17.7.1 EOL on specific iPads, some iPads might need to keep its existing support)
A12: until iOS 17.3.1 (iOS 16.5.1 if the remaining issues persist)
A13+A14: until iOS 17.3.1
A15+: until iOS 17.3.1
M1 and M2 should be supported as well but these chipsets are always a little confusing.
There is also another kernel exploit on iOS 17.2.1 and below which could be more reliable and quicker than DarkSword if reversed.
